Curated by Christian Viveros-Fauné, this exhibition at Museum of Contemporary Art Quinta Normal raises questions about the culture of representation and continues the museum’s tradition of presenting challenging artwork with political and social content in Chile. People I Met is a series of images that show the lives of Palestinians in the occupied territories, captured over Miki Kratsman’s decades-long photography career working in Gaza and the West Bank. The images, which exist as cropped portraits on a Facebook page, are isolated from their original frame and context. The faces are uploaded with just the date, location and Kratsman’s simple question: “What happened to the people in the photographs?”
